|
- -- CREATE OR REPLACE FILE FORMAT parquetformat TYPE = parquet;
-
- COPY INTO addresses
- FROM (
- SELECT $1:address_lookup,
- $1:address_resolved,
- $1:lat,
- $1:long,
- $1:match_indicator,
- $1:match_type,
- $1:tiger_line_id,
- $1:tiger_side
- FROM @FINANCE_PARQUET/addresses.parquet (FILE_FORMAT => "PARQUETFORMAT")
- );
-
- COPY INTO cl_candidates
- FROM (
- SELECT $1:candidate_id,
- $1:name_on_ballot,
- $1:first_name,
- $1:middle_name,
- $1:last_name,
- $1:name_suffix_lbl,
- $1:party_last,
- $1:party_most,
- $1:contest_n,
- $1:contest_first,
- $1:contest_latest,
- $1:street,
- $1:city,
- $1:state,
- $1:zip_code,
- $1:phone,
- $1:email,
- $1:address_lookup
- FROM @FINANCE_PARQUET/cl_candidates.parquet (FILE_FORMAT => "PARQUETFORMAT")
- );
-
- COPY INTO cl_contact
- FROM (
- SELECT $1:candidate_id,
- $1:election_dt,
- $1:street,
- $1:city,
- $1:state,
- $1:zip_code,
- $1:phone,
- $1:email,
- $1:address_lookup
- FROM @FINANCE_PARQUET/cl_contact.parquet (FILE_FORMAT => "PARQUETFORMAT")
- );
-
- COPY INTO cl_elections
- FROM (
- SELECT $1:election_dt,
- $1:county_name,
- $1:contest_name,
- $1:candidate_id,
- $1:first_name,
- $1:middle_name,
- $1:last_name,
- $1:name_suffix_lbl
- FROM @FINANCE_PARQUET/cl_elections.parquet (FILE_FORMAT => "PARQUETFORMAT")
- );
-
- COPY INTO cl_name_on_ballot
- FROM (
- SELECT $1:candidate_id,
- $1:election_dt,
- $1:name_on_ballot,
- $1:first_name,
- $1:middle_name,
- $1:last_name,
- $1:name_suffix_lbl
- FROM @FINANCE_PARQUET/cl_name_on_ballot.parquet (FILE_FORMAT => "PARQUETFORMAT")
- );
-
- COPY INTO cl_party
- FROM (
- SELECT $1:candidate_id,
- $1:election_dt,
- $1:party_candidate
- FROM @FINANCE_PARQUET/cl_party.parquet (FILE_FORMAT => "PARQUETFORMAT")
- );
-
- COPY INTO committee_candidate
- FROM (
- SELECT $1:sboe_id,
- $1:candidate_id
- FROM @FINANCE_PARQUET/committee_candidate.parquet (FILE_FORMAT => "PARQUETFORMAT")
- );
-
- COPY INTO committees
- FROM (
- SELECT $1:sboe_id,
- $1:committee_name,
- $1:report_id,
- $1:street_1,
- $1:street_2,
- $1:city,
- $1:state,
- $1:zip_code,
- $1:address_lookup,
- $1:committee_type,
- $1:fund_type,
- $1:fund_name
- FROM @FINANCE_PARQUET/committees.parquet (FILE_FORMAT => "PARQUETFORMAT")
- );
-
- COPY INTO cover
- FROM (
- SELECT $1:report_id,
- $1:sboe_id,
- $1:committee_name,
- $1:street_1,
- $1:street_2,
- $1:city,
- $1:state,
- $1:zip_code,
- $1:country,
- $1:postal_code,
- $1:committee_type,
- $1:report_type,
- $1:fund_type,
- $1:fund_name,
- $1:date_from,
- $1:date_to,
- $1:date_filed
- FROM @FINANCE_PARQUET/cover.parquet (FILE_FORMAT => "PARQUETFORMAT")
- );
-
- COPY INTO expenses
- FROM (
- SELECT $1:sboe_id,
- $1:report_id,
- $1:payee_id,
- $1:occur_date,
- $1:amount,
- $1:sum_to_date,
- $1:is_aggregated,
- $1:purpose_type_code,
- $1:purpose,
- $1:expenditure_type_desc,
- $1:account_abbr,
- $1:form_of_payment_desc
- FROM @FINANCE_PARQUET/expenses.parquet (FILE_FORMAT => "PARQUETFORMAT")
- );
-
- COPY INTO expenses_payee
- FROM (
- SELECT $1:payee_id,
- $1:org_name,
- $1:is_org,
- $1:is_us,
- $1:profession,
- $1:employers_name,
- $1:street_1,
- $1:street_2,
- $1:city,
- $1:state,
- $1:full_zip,
- $1:country_name,
- $1:address_lookup
- FROM @FINANCE_PARQUET/expenses_payee.parquet (FILE_FORMAT => "PARQUETFORMAT")
- );
-
- COPY INTO officers
- FROM (
- SELECT $1:sboe_id,
- $1:report_id,
- $1:type,
- $1:name,
- $1:address_lookup,
- $1:phone
- FROM @FINANCE_PARQUET/officers.parquet (FILE_FORMAT => "PARQUETFORMAT")
- );
-
- COPY INTO receipts
- FROM (
- SELECT $1:sboe_id,
- $1:report_id,
- $1:payer_id,
- $1:group_id,
- $1:occur_date,
- $1:amount,
- $1:sum_to_date,
- $1:is_aggregated,
- $1:receipt_type_desc,
- $1:receipt_type_code,
- $1:is_donation,
- $1:account_abbr,
- $1:form_of_payment_desc,
- $1:is_prior
- FROM @FINANCE_PARQUET/receipts.parquet (FILE_FORMAT => "PARQUETFORMAT")
- );
-
- COPY INTO receipts_payer
- FROM (
- SELECT $1:payer_id,
- $1:org_name,
- $1:is_org,
- $1:is_us,
- $1:profession,
- $1:employers_name,
- $1:street_1,
- $1:city,
- $1:state,
- $1:full_zip,
- $1:country_name,
- $1:address_lookup
- FROM @FINANCE_PARQUET/receipts_payer.parquet (FILE_FORMAT => "PARQUETFORMAT")
- );
-
- COPY INTO reports
- FROM (
- SELECT $1:year,
- $1:doc_name,
- $1:doc_order,
- $1:sboe_id,
- $1:report_id,
- $1:amended,
- $1:image_id,
- $1:received_image,
- $1:received_data,
- $1:start_date,
- $1:end_date,
- $1:sboe_start_date,
- $1:sboe_end_date,
- $1:cover_start_date,
- $1:cover_end_date,
- $1:cover_date_filed
- FROM @FINANCE_PARQUET/reports.parquet (FILE_FORMAT => "PARQUETFORMAT")
- );
-
- COPY INTO voters
- FROM (
- SELECT $1:county_id,
- $1:county_desc,
- $1:voter_reg_num,
- $1:ncid,
- $1:last_name,
- $1:first_name,
- $1:middle_name,
- $1:name_suffix_lbl,
- $1:status_cd,
- $1:voter_status_desc,
- $1:reason_cd,
- $1:voter_status_reason_desc,
- $1:res_street_address,
- $1:res_city_desc,
- $1:state_cd,
- $1:zip_code,
- $1:mail_addr1,
- $1:mail_addr2,
- $1:mail_addr3,
- $1:mail_addr4,
- $1:mail_city,
- $1:mail_state,
- $1:mail_zipcode,
- $1:full_phone_number,
- $1:confidential_ind,
- $1:registr_dt,
- $1:race_code,
- $1:ethnic_code,
- $1:party_cd,
- $1:gender_code,
- $1:birth_year,
- $1:age_at_year_end,
- $1:birth_state,
- $1:drivers_lic,
- $1:precinct_abbrv,
- $1:precinct_desc,
- $1:municipality_abbrv,
- $1:municipality_desc,
- $1:ward_abbrv,
- $1:ward_desc,
- $1:cong_dist_abbrv,
- $1:super_court_abbrv,
- $1:judic_dist_abbrv,
- $1:nc_senate_abbrv,
- $1:nc_house_abbrv,
- $1:county_commiss_abbrv,
- $1:county_commiss_desc,
- $1:township_abbrv,
- $1:township_desc,
- $1:school_dist_abbrv,
- $1:school_dist_desc,
- $1:fire_dist_abbrv,
- $1:fire_dist_desc,
- $1:water_dist_abbrv,
- $1:water_dist_desc,
- $1:sewer_dist_abbrv,
- $1:sewer_dist_desc,
- $1:sanit_dist_abbrv,
- $1:sanit_dist_desc,
- $1:rescue_dist_abbrv,
- $1:rescue_dist_desc,
- $1:munic_dist_abbrv,
- $1:munic_dist_desc,
- $1:dist_1_abbrv,
- $1:dist_1_desc,
- $1:vtd_abbrv,
- $1:vtd_desc
- FROM @FINANCE_PARQUET/voters.parquet (FILE_FORMAT => "PARQUETFORMAT")
- );
|